The Dos and Don’ts of Online Dating in Germany: Navigating the Digital Romance Scene

Germany, known for its efficiency and directness, offers a unique perspective on online dating. While international platforms like Tinder and Bumble are popular, navigating the German dating scene requires a blend of cultural awareness and digital savvy. Here’s a guide on the dos and don’ts of finding love online in Deutschland:

Dos

  • Be Honest & Direct: Germans value authenticity and clarity. Don’t be afraid to express your intentions openly and be upfront about what you’re looking for.
  • Focus on Quality over Quantity: While swiping on multiple profiles might seem tempting, prioritize quality conversations with genuine connections.
  • Take the Initiative: Don’t be afraid to initiate conversations, suggest activities, or plan dates. German dating culture embraces a balanced approach to initiating.
  • Embrace Punctuality: Germans are known for their punctuality. Be on time for your dates and respect others’ time.
  • Learn Basic German: Even a few phrases in German can go a long way. It shows effort and respect for the culture.
  • Talk about Interests: Germans love discussing topics they’re passionate about. Prepare to engage in meaningful conversations about hobbies, travel, or current affairs.
  • Be Open-Minded: German dating culture is diverse. Keep an open mind and be open to exploring connections with people from various backgrounds and life experiences.

Don’ts

  • Avoid Clichéd Pick-Up Lines: German humor can be dry and witty. Avoid cheesy or overly familiar greetings.
  • Don’t Be Overly Romantic: German dating culture tends to be more grounded and realistic. Avoid overly grand gestures, especially early on.
  • Don’t Show Up Empty-Handed: While bringing a small gift is not mandatory, it’s a nice gesture to show appreciation for your date’s time and effort.
  • Don’t Be overly touchy-feely: Germans generally prefer a more reserved approach to physical affection, especially in the early stages of dating.
  • Don’t Avoid Difficult Topics: Germans value open communication. Don’t shy away from discussing expectations and relationship goals honestly.
  • Don’t Ghost: If you’re not interested, politely decline further interaction or clearly communicate your intentions.
  • Don’t Be Pushy: Respect your date’s boundaries and decisions.

Remember:

Online dating in Germany is about building genuine connections. Be yourself, be respectful, and enjoy the process of getting to know someone new. With a little effort and cultural awareness, you can navigate the German dating scene successfully and find your perfect match.
